LUDWIGSHAFEN, Germany, December 24 /PRNewswire/ — Every winter it’s the
same old problem: Ice and snow wreak havoc with traffic. To battle the slick
roads, the winter services people are out there day and night spreading salt
on the streets. In entertaining episodes our Chemical Reporter answers
questions of our Podcast listeners on Chemistry in our everyday life.

BASF is the world’s leading chemical company: The Chemical Company. Its
portfolio ranges from oil and gas to chemicals, plastics, performance
products, agricultural products and fine chemicals. As a reliable partner
BASF helps its customers in virtually all industries to be more successful.
With its high-value products and intelligent solutions, BASF plays an
important role in finding answers to global challenges such as climate
protection, energy efficiency, nutrition and mobility. BASF has more than
95,000 employees and posted sales of almost EUR58 billion in 2007. BASF
shares are traded on the stock exchanges in Frankfurt (BAS), London (BFA) and
Zurich (AN). Further information on BASF is available on the Internet at
